Today, across the country, we came together to say loud and clear: Youth Homelessness Matters.

To every person who shared, spoke up, showed up, or simply took a moment to listen - Yfoundations extends our heartfelt thanks.

In 2023–24, over 43,000 children and young people under 25 sought help from homelessness services alone. Nearly half faced mental ill-health, and over a third experienced domestic and family violence.

It doesn’t end here. Youth Homelessness Matters Every Day. And we are still firm in our commitment to making youth homelessness a national priority.

Acting Out – On Screen is a 4-day intensive school holiday film program providing social connection and creative expression opportunities to LGBTQIA+ youth aged 12-17 years. The program is led by professional film/theatre tutors and trained support workers who identify as LGBTQIA+ who will guide the participants in writing, directing, shooting and editing their own original short film.

In this program participants:
- Take part in team building games and exercises
- Learn acting, film and screen techniques in an inclusive and supportive environment
- Write, shoot, and edit a number of new works about themes that are important to them

Our partners at Capital Region Community Services can provide transport for participants in the Belconnen, Woden and Inner North areas (through gold coin donation per trip) so please indicate in your enrolment form if you would like to utilise this service.

Lunch and snacks will also be provided for participants.
